30 cities, one field – GoDaddy puts them head-to-head
Game on! As the fall football season ignites excitement across the country, GoDaddy (NYSE: GDDY) has announced its Entrepreneurial Power Rankings. This initiative pits 30 cities known for their deep-rooted passion for professional football against each other in a spirited competition for small business supremacy.
Understanding the Rankings
GoDaddy's Power Rankings are calculated based on the number of entrepreneurs per 100 people and encompass not just pro football stadiums but also vibrant downtown and suburban areas. These locales are witnessing an increase in small and microbusinesses—predominantly with fewer than 10 employees. Many of these entrepreneurs are emerging and expanding right in the midst of game-day enthusiasm, tourism, and local talent stimulated by numerous entertainment events.
Significant Insights from the Power Rankings
The outcomes of the Entrepreneurial Power Rankings shed light on several compelling insights:
- Entrepreneurs thrive in pro football cities. Almost every metro area featured in the rankings boasts a higher number of entrepreneurs per 100 people than the national average, with the exception of Pittsburgh, which barely missed the mark. These findings underscore the robust entrepreneurial spirit present in communities neighboring pro football stadiums.
- Florida leads the charge. The entrepreneurial trifecta of Miami Gardens, Tampa, and Jacksonville showcases how Florida's advantageous elements—consistent population growth, diverse cultural foundations, and inviting weather—symbiotically encourage small business development.
- Mid-sized metros are significant players. Cities such as Glendale, AZ, and Nashville, TN, illustrate how livable, affordable, and digitally connected suburban regions within mid-sized metros are pivotal contributors to economic growth across the nation.
According to Alexandra Rosen, an economist and global head of the GoDaddy Small Business Research Lab, "The concentration of small business entrepreneurs around pro football stadiums reflects the considerable economic activity generated by game days and various events at some of America's largest venues." She emphasized how small businesses create local jobs and significantly impact customers and vendors well beyond their immediate areas, especially with a proper digital presence.

Insights from the GoDaddy Small Business Research Lab
Continuous research from the GoDaddy Small Business Research Lab highlights a few crucial traits of small business entrepreneurs:
- They often embark on their journeys with minimal or no external funding.
- They are diverse, with many representing women, immigrants, or people of color.
- Initially, many do not label themselves as "entrepreneurs"; instead, they pursue their passions.
- Resilience is vital; they frequently rebound after setbacks and closures, underscoring their indomitable spirits.

About GoDaddy Small Business Research Lab
The GoDaddy Small Business Research Lab, previously known as Venture Forward, delves into over 20 million online businesses characterized by having a unique domain and an active website. Most of these entities are microbusinesses, employing fewer than ten individuals. Since its inception in 2018, the program has conducted surveys reaching more than 50,000 entrepreneurs, establishing itself as a prominent source of data and insights regarding microbusiness trends.
